Crawlspace water cleanup services focus on removing excess moisture, standing water, and residual dampness from beneath a property. This process typically involves thorough extraction of water, drying out affected areas, and addressing any sources of ongoing moisture. The goal is to eliminate conditions that could lead to further damage, such as mold growth, wood rot, or structural deterioration. Professionals use specialized equipment to ensure that the crawlspace is properly dried and dehumidified, helping to restore the area to a safe and stable condition.
Water intrusion in crawlspaces can cause significant problems if left unaddressed. Persistent moisture can promote mold and mildew development, which may impact indoor air quality and pose health risks. Additionally, excess water can weaken structural components like beams and joists, leading to costly repairs over time. Crawlspace water cleanup services help mitigate these issues by removing water quickly and effectively, preventing long-term damage and reducing the risk of pest infestations that thrive in damp environments.

Professional crawlspace water cleanup services typically involve a detailed assessment of the affected area, followed by tailored removal and drying strategies. Service providers utilize specialized equipment such as industrial-grade pumps, dehumidifiers, and air movers to thoroughly dry the space. They also identify and repair sources of water intrusion, which may include sealing cracks, fixing drainage issues, or addressing plumbing leaks. Cost of Water Cleanup in Crawlspaces - Typical expenses for crawlspace water cleanup services range from $500 to $3,000, depending on the extent of the water damage and necessary remediation. For minor issues, costs may be closer to $500, while extensive flooding can reach higher amounts.
Average Service Charges - The average cost for professional water removal and cleanup services in crawlspaces is approximately $1,200 to $2,500. Factors influencing costs include the size of the area and the severity of water intrusion.
Factors Affecting Cost - Costs vary based on the severity of water infiltration, the size of the crawlspace, and the level of cleanup required. For example, a small, minor leak may cost around $500, whereas major flooding could cost over $3,000.
Additional Expenses - Additional costs may include mold remediation or drying equipment rental, which can add $200 to $1,000 to the total. These expenses depend on the specific needs identified by local service providers during assessment.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es water in a crawlspace? Water in a crawlspace can result from heavy rainfall, poor drainage, plumbing leaks, or high groundwater levels that seep through the foundation.
How do professionals remove water from a crawlspace? Trained service providers typically use pumps, wet vacuums, and dehumidifiers to extract standing water and dry the area thoroughly.
Is it necessary to address water issues immediately? Yes, prompt action is recommended to prevent mold growth, structural damage, and further water intrusion problems.
What are common signs of crawlspace water damage? Signs include musty odors, visible water or dampness, mold growth, and wood rot or warping of framing materials.
How can water problems in a crawlspace be prevented? Proper drainage, sealing foundation cracks, installing vapor barriers, and maintaining gutters can help reduce the risk of water intrusion.
